    Job title: IT Support Specialist/ Desktop Support Specialist

    Engagement: Contract to Hire

    Location: 73116, Oklahoma City, Oklahoma, United States

    Day to Day Responsibilities:

    • Oversees the daily operations for a specified location including software, hardware, tape backups, phone administration, and the local area network.
    • Provides level I & II end-user support for software and hardware issues.
    • Oversees the daily operations of the local area network.
    • Installs and upgrades Microsoft Windows operating systems including standard business applications and associated peripherals.
    • Troubleshoots Desktop Virus and malware issues.
    • Maintains a daily backup of all network files.
    • Performs service administration tasks for software and hardware products to ensure manufacturer warranty.
    • Troubleshoots any software and hardware problems through debugging, testing, and vendor assistance.
    • Performs software and hardware inventory.

    Years' Experience Required:

    • 5+ Years of Experience is Required
    • 10+ Years is Preferred
    • Education Requirements: HSD
    • Systems/Software Proficiencies: ServiceNow or any comparable ticketing system,
    • Certifications: A+ PC Technician; Both Network + and Dell Hardware certification is a plus.

    Top Must Have Skills:

    • Troubleshooting PC Hardware, Windows, Outlook/365, Web browsers.
    • Strong focus on customer service and communication skills (exceptional). - Resource will work with internal teams including Marketing (needs someone with sense of urgency and ability to communicate effectively to broad audiences)
    • Ability to triage incoming ticket requests and prioritize - fast paced. Strong engagement with end users required.
    • Ability to comprehend and interpret instructions, short correspondence, and memos and ask clarifying questions to ensure understanding.
    • Routine reporting and data integrity.
